There were 4 fewer active legal licenses in Torrance County in October than previous month

7edited

There were four fewer active legal licenses in Torrance County in October compared to the previous month, according to the State Bar of New Mexico.

There were three active legal licenses in Torrance County in October, compared to seven the month before.

Data refers to all lawyers who were actively practicing during this time period.

As of 2023, the average salary for a lawyer in New Mexico is approximately $96,071 per year.

New Mexico faces a severe shortage of lawyers. Two of its counties have no attorneys, and 21% of the state's counties have no more than five lawyers.
